"The Trumpet Shall Sound", in this arrangement, is the 'Recitative' and Bass 'Aria' from "The Messiah" composed by G.F. Händel. It is recommended that at least the Harpsichord and Organ (and the violin, if possible) be part of the ensemble as this will sound close to and orchestra. The second, sadly, part may be omitted...traditionally.
Professional arrangements of this Aria, it would seem, is not much requested (or available) as sheet music.
This song was commissioned by a South African Baritone Soloist, Johann Nefdt, to be performed by a Baritone Soloist, Violin, Trumpet, Harpsichord & Pipe-Organ (a Piano part, included, is most welcome to join the ensemble as it's overtones will fill out the score).
This sale includes two Score & Parts sets, in DMaj & Cmaj. Enjoy!
